Chatham Train Station is equipped with a variety of facilities to ensure a smooth and comfortable journey for passengers. The ticket office is open daily, fitting into a variety of timeframes. Ticket machines for both buying and collection, including accessible machines in the booking hall, are available for those in a hurry or with special needs.
For passengers needing assistance, the station provides step-free access throughout, making it easily navigable for all. Waiting rooms are located on platforms 1 and 2, readily available until 8 PM, offering a heated space to relax before your train departs. Passengers can also enjoy the refreshment facilities, including a buffet on platform 1 and a Starbucks located in the booking hall to grab a quick bite or sip a warm coffee.
Chatham is not just about the trains. The station's transport links extend to a well-organized network of buses and taxis. Ideal for seamless onward journeys, the rail replacement services have a designated bus stop at the bus interchange to the right of the station entrance. Taxis are conveniently located at the station forecourt, ensuring you can find a ride swiftly. Colchester Town Station is set up to ensure a smooth and comfortable journey for all travelers. The ticket office is open from 06:10 to 20:15 on weekdays and slightly shorter hours on Saturdays, providing ample opportunity for passengers to purchase and collect tickets. There's no need to worry if you’re catching an early or late train, as ticket machines are available around the clock, and they even support smartcard validators.
For those requiring assistance, station staff are on hand to offer help and support during ticket office hours. There are also help points and screens to keep you informed about departures. Notably, the station offers step-free access, making it easy for everyone to navigate, and it's equipped with an induction loop for those with hearing impairments.
Need a quick refreshment before you board? Stop by the 'Steam' kiosk for a coffee and snack. Free parking is available at a local council-managed car park, minus accessible spaces, but if you're arriving by bike, there are sheltered stands for safe storage. Unfortunately, the station doesn’t offer luggage storage or accessible toilets, but basic toilet facilities are available during select hours.
Stepping out of Colchester Town Station, you'll discover various transport links to continue your journey. It’s only a five-minute walk to the Colchester Bus Station. When there are engineering works or service disruptions, the local bus services, including routes 61, 62, 65, and 66, accept rail tickets to help passengers reach alternative nearby stations. Just keep an eye out for the replacement bus stop near the Magistrates' Court if you need a shuttle due to planned engineering works.
